Rep Power: 0 | | Reckless Driving Ok, so i was driving home friday night, and i was doing so angrily, so i was speeding, i saw a cop and it was to late, i knew he was going to pull me over, so i got into a parking lot, and sure enough, as soon as i turned, lights turned on. he did his usual thing, and told me i was going 86 in a 45. So i have a court date. first thing i need to no, is there any way that they may reduce the charge so i can just get a regular speeding ticket? I am a 17 year old kid, but i will be 18 before the court date, it is at juvinile court, do i still need a parent? this is my first offense. i am in the process of obtaining my eagle scout, and my dad recently lost his job so i had to pick up some of the bills. I dont have to much to spend, but will do my best for whatever fine they give me or what not, but the biggest thing that makes my sad  is the insurance, nothing i can do about that. This all happened on 28 in VA. |

Rep Power: 10 | | Re: Reckless Driving I'm going to give you an opinion.... I think reckless driving and speeding are some of the most difficult tickets to beat... Most of the time, it's very difficult to beat a police officers statement who appears on a speeding ticket... But a lot depends on the court... Here in New York, most courts rarely reduce speeders, but courts which are particulary busy will reduce iinfractions, points, and fines for speedy guilty pleas - so much will depend on the court... I'm unfirmiliar with VA traffic courts, but I recommend, on a hefty charge like excessive speeding (which it looks as you were doing [excessive is usually over 15 MPG higher than limit]) or reckless driving where it will strongly effect your license an insurance to appear with a lawyer... A consult with a lawyer in VA, will know by the court address on the appearence ticket just how flexable those courts are.
